(FOX40.COM) -- A 37-year-old man was arrested after he assaulted a teen girl in a hate crime while she was walking to school, according to the Fairfield Police Department. • Video Above: How to report a public safety threat
On Wednesday morning, Fairfield High School staff was notified that one of their students, a teenage girl, was assaulted by a man while walking to school. It was reported to the school resource officers, who responded to assist the victim.
According to FPD, the student was taken to a local hospital for an evaluation. During the investigation, officers learned that the student was walking near the 300 block of Dahlia Street when she was approached by a resident, later identified as Victor Viera Chavez, 37, of Fairfield.
